What is the purpose of a website for church organizations?
Websites for church organizations play a special role.
They are a central contact point for faith, guidance and community – and at the same time a practical information medium.
Whether parish, pastoral district, deanery, church construction/maintenance association, or church sponsor:
A church website informs about offerings, responsibilities, buildings and events, and supports people in real-life situations.
Typical contents are:
- historical backgrounds
- information about church buildings and their maintenance
- notes on donations and funding opportunities
- clear contact options for pastoral and administrative concerns
A church website is not a marketing instrument, but a reliable, enduring information source.
Available around the clock for people with concrete concerns
People visit church websites with clear expectations. Common reasons include:
- Moving to a new parish
- Baptism, wedding or confirmation
- Death and wish for a church funeral
- Searching for contacts or appointment times
Parish offices and clergy are not constantly available.
The website is it – 24 hours a day.
It consolidates all relevant information in one place, clearly organized, understandable and up-to-date. This is exactly where it is decided whether a website is helpful or not.
What should be on a professional website for church institutions?
What belongs on a professional website for church institutions?
A well-structured church website includes, among other things:
Core Content
- Contact & Points of Contact
for larger institutions, organized by topics or responsibilities - Hours of operation and responsibilities
- Event calendar
- News from parish life
- Groups, circles and regular offerings
- Information about properties
e.g., churches, cemeteries, parish houses - Room rental (if relevant)
Supplementary Content
- Faith impulses, devotions, sermons
- Worship services as podcast or video
- Social media links
- Downloads (parish newsletters, flyers, forms)
- Information on art and architecture
- Donation appeals for the preservation of church buildings
The key is a clear information architecture and upkeep that works in everyday life.
